Alex9999
Alex9999
全部文章
分类
归档
标签
去牛客网
登录
/
注册
Alex9999的博客
全部文章
(共27篇)
题解 | 单组_二维数组
#两个for循环 total_sum = 0 cloum=[] n, m = map(int, input().split()) for i in range(n): cloum=list(map(int,input().split())) total_sum+=su...
2025-11-25
0
4
题解 | 校门外的树
L,M=map(int,input().split()) Tree=[1]*(L+1)#长度为L,1为种满了树 cun=0 for i in range(M): l,r=map(int,input().split()) for j in range(l,r+1): T...
2025-11-24
0
6
题解 | 约瑟夫环
n,k ,m=map(int,input().split()) arr=list(map(int,range(n)))#列表人数 #遍历列表至k while len(arr) !=1: k=(k+m-1)%len(arr)#k+m-用于计算下一次的位置,%len(arr)用于进行循环! ...
2025-11-18
0
15
题解 | 数组计数维护
S=0 cnt=0 T=int(input()) for _ in range(T): n,k=list(map(int,input().split())) num=list(map(int, input().split())) for i in range(n): ...
2025-11-14
0
15
题解 | 左侧严格小于计数
n=int(input()) arr=[int(i) for i in input().split()] count=0 for i in range(len(arr)): if i==0: print('0',end=' ') continue el...
2025-11-14
0
13
题解 | 牛牛学数列4
n=int(input()) sum=0 for i in range(n+1): # 每一项的通项公式:ix(n-(i-1)) sum=i*(n-(i-1))+sum print(sum)
2025-11-13
0
13
题解 | 牛牛学数列6
n=int(input()) def An(n): if n==1: return 0 if n==2 or n==3: return 1 else: return An(n-3)+2*An(n-2)+An(n-1) print...
2025-11-13
0
12
题解 | 牛牛数数
n=int(input()) for i in range(n+1): #先判断倍数关系 if i%4==0: continue #判断是否包含4(用字符串对比) char=str(i) if '4' in char: cont...
2025-11-13
0
14
题解 | 数位之和
n=input() sum=0 for i in range(len(n)): value=int(n[-i])#由于字符串从0开始计数,这里使用-1开始倒序计数 if value<0: value=-value sum=sum+value print(...
2025-11-13
0
16
题解 | 牛牛学数列5
n=int(input()) def Fb(n): if n==1: return 1 elif n==2: return 1 else: return Fb(n-1)+Fb(n-2) print(Fb(n))
2025-11-13
0
13
首页
上一页
1
2
3
下一页
末页